Olembe Stadium to host international matches as from September

The 60.000-seater capacity Olembe Sports Complex earmarked to host the opening and closing encounters of the upcoming 2021 AFCON will be ready to host national and international matches as from September 2021, this according to the top staff of the Canadian Construction Company, MAGIL.

The declaration was made this Thursday, June 24, 2021 during the weekly routine visits of the Minister of Sports and Physical Education, President of the Local Organising Committee of the 2021 AFCON (COCAN), Narcisse Mouelle Kombi.

The Minister and his crew were assured that finishing touches are being done at the main stadium to ensure that matches can be fielded soonest without any fear of doubt.

According to an official of the construction company, the mild works at the football facility for the moment are the installation of the sound systems, the lighting of the stadium, the electrification process amongst many other things

A top staff, Yoann Ropital told Minister Narcisse Mouelle Kombi and Cameroonians no to worry because the difficulties faced in the past have been taken care of by the government.

He insisted that the stadium is expected to posses the largest number of camera outlets on the African Continent upon its completion.

The Minister of Sports and Physical Education was a visibly satisfied man at the end of the inspection tour of the annex stadium, the athletics lane, the media rooms etc.

The sports boss said the same spirit of team work has to be portrayed by the company so as to meet up with the various deadlines given to the state of Cameroon and the football powerhouse, CAF

Professor Narcisse Mouelle kombi insisted on the fact that all what CAF expects from Cameroon for Olembe to host the opening ceremony and other matches of AFCON 2021 should be ready before the end of October 2021.

He noted with a lot of fonfidence that the approval of the proposed Mascot, theme song, the inauguration of a temporal CAF bureau in Yaounde are just few of the many factors that Cameroon will host her AFCON and on the time schedule.

Just to note that, the Secretary General of CAF, Veron Mesongo said Cameroon will host the draw event of the 2021 AFCON during the month of August 2021 in Yaounde.

The Minister will visit infrastructure and facilities in the town of Garoua in the North of Cameroon earmarked to play host to the African Cup of Nations in January 2022.
